IEM Kolkata B.Tech & MBA Admission 2026: Key Dates & Eligibility

For Institute of Engineering and Management Admission 2026, key dates and eligibility criteria for B.Tech and MBA programs are crucial. The WBJEE 2026 exam for BE/BTech admissions is scheduled for May 24, 2026, with JEE Main Session 2 results expected by April 20, 2026.

  • WBJEE 2026 Exam Date: May 24, 2026, for BE/BTech admissions.
  • JEE Main 2026 Session 2 Results: Expected by April 20, 2026.
  • B.Tech General Selection: Qualified WBJEE/IEMJEE/JEE Mains, followed by WBJEE counseling.
  • B.Tech General Eligibility: Passed 10+2 with PCB, minimum 45% marks.
  • MBA General Selection: Pass CAT/JEMAT exams, then PI and GD rounds.
  • MBA General Eligibility: 60% marks throughout 10th, 12th, and Graduation.

Beyond these general requirements, specific B.Tech programs at IEM Kolkata have varying academic prerequisites. Detailed eligibility for various engineering branches and further MBA selection criteria are outlined below.

Program/CriteriaDetails
B.Tech Eligibility (IEM Official Site)
CSE (AI), IT10th: 70%, 12th: 70%, PCM: 50%
CSE (AI & ML)10th: 75%, 12th: 75%, PCM: 50%
CSE (DS), AI & DS, IOT, IOT CS BCT, Cyber Security, BIO-TECH, ECE, Electrical, Mechanical10th: 60%, 12th: 60%, PCM: 45%
B.Tech Selection CriteriaIEMJEE Counselling
MBA Eligibility (IEM Official Site Table)
Class 10th55% Marks
Class 12th55% Marks
Graduation55% Marks
MBA Selection Criteria (IEM Official Site)
GeneralCAT/MAT Cleared, appear for Aptitude and GD/PI
SpecificCAT/MAT
Important Dates/Status
JEE Main 2026 Session 1 & 2 ExamsConcluded
WBJEE 2026 RegistrationClosed
CAT 2026 Registration StartExpected August 2026
XAT 2026 Result (MBA/PGDM)Declared

These detailed criteria highlight the varying academic requirements for different B.Tech specializations and the specific entrance exams and interview rounds for MBA admissions at the Institute of Engineering and Management Admission.

IEM Kolkata B.Tech & MBA Fee Structure 2026: Course-wise Details

The detailed B.Tech fee structure for 2026 at IEM Kolkata outlines an annual fee of ₹2,16,250, totaling ₹8,65,000 over four years. This section provides a comprehensive overview of B.Tech, MBA, and other associated costs for Institute of Engineering and Management Admission.

Component1st Year2nd Year3rd Year4th YearTotal
Tuition Fee₹1,82,000₹1,82,000₹1,82,000₹1,82,000₹7,28,000
Development Fee₹20,000₹20,000₹20,000₹20,000₹80,000
Lab & Library₹10,000₹10,000₹10,000₹10,000₹40,000
Other Charges₹4,250₹4,250₹4,250₹4,250₹17,000
Total Annual Fee₹2,16,250₹2,16,250₹2,16,250₹2,16,250₹8,65,000

This breakdown shows the consistent annual fee components for B.Tech students, culminating in a total of ₹8,65,000 for the entire four-year program, providing clarity for prospective Institute of Engineering and Management Admission candidates.

  • B.Tech Management Quota Total Fee: ₹10-12 Lakhs (4 years)
  • B.Tech Management Quota Donation: ₹2-4 Lakhs (one-time, varies by branch)
  • MBA Total Fee (IEM Group Admission): Rs.7,00,000/- (4 semesters)
  • MCA Total Fee (IEM Group Admission): Rs.3,00,000/- (4 semesters)
  • Hostel Fees (Annual): Boys: ₹75,000-₹90,000; Girls: ₹80,000-₹95,000
  • Additional First Year Charge - Uniform: ₹6,500 (one-time)
